Output 78c81605de06cc34ec63ddb079e42f3f431d74e0a5e30e6a60ea19069f8452e4:45

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0804c1da7c54b01f676b14e52af408d54de80b8a29b1ba5d31ecda9c12125b40
address
bc1ppqzvrknu2jcp7emtznjj4aqg64x7szu29xcm5hf3andfcysjtdqq5n7mkg
transaction
78c81605de06cc34ec63ddb079e42f3f431d74e0a5e30e6a60ea19069f8452e4
spent
true